Allianz SE acquired a new stake in shares of iShares Blockchain and Tech ETF (NYSEARCA:IBLC – Free Report) in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or acquired 1,646 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$56,000. Allianz SE owned about 0.24% of iShares Blockchain and Tech ETF as of its most recent SEC filing.
iShares Blockchain and Tech ETF Stock Performance
IBLC stock opened at $24.68 on Tuesday. iShares Blockchain and Tech ETF has a 1 year low of $23.89 and a 1 year high of $46.96. The stock has a market capitalization of $28.38 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 15.39 and a beta of 3.17. The stock’s fifty day moving average is $31.86 and its two-hundred day moving average is $34.35.
